Summary
Fan He is an accomplished Associate Chief Engineer specializing in battery module products at Gotion Inc., located in the vibrant tech hub of San Francisco, California. With a Ph.D. in Mechanical Engineering from Virginia Tech and extensive experience in the automotive and energy sectors, he has a robust background in thermal management, battery dynamics, and system design. Fan's innovative contributions include developing advanced thermal control systems and battery modeling methodologies that have significantly improved energy efficiency in hybrid vehicles. He is multilingual, fluent in English, Chinese, and Japanese, which enhances his ability to collaborate in diverse environments. His research work has led to several patents, showcasing his commitment to innovation in energy management. Fan's leadership experience is complemented by his teaching roles at Virginia Tech, where he has educated future engineers. He is passionate about integrating emerging technologies into sustainable energy solutions.
